asked the Minister for Lands whether he is aware that there is a widespread demand in the Emly district, County Tipperary, for the division of the Ryan Estate at Ballyholihan and the O'Connor Estate at Knockcarron; whether it has been represented to him that the delay in dealing with these estates is causing grave discontent in the locality and whether he is in a position to state if these estates will be acquired for subdivision at an early date.
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- Division of Tipperary Estates.
The Land Commission propose as soon as possible to have inspections made of the two estates of Ryan and O'Connor mentioned in the Deputy's question, with a view to ascertaining their suitability for acquisition. The Land Commission are not at present in a position to say whether, or when, these estates will be acquired, but the relative proceedings will be expedited.
